Last second win by UCSB gives Bob Williams his 500th coaching victory

Alex Hart’s tip-in with 2.5 seconds left allowed UCSB to avoid some dubious school history and at the same time give coach Bob Williams a milestone victory.

Tied at 54 with Hawaii and time winding down, Clifton Powell Jr. missed a jumper but Hart’s putback snapped an 8-game losing streak for UCSB. The Gauchos are now 4-20 on the year. No UCSB team has ever lost 21 times in a single season.

Hart finished with 16 points.

For Williams, it was career coaching win number 500.

The Gauchos host Long Beach State on Saturday at 4.
